The campus community at Chapman splits into full-time and part-time students as follows:
| Full-time | Part-time | Total |
|---|---|---|
| 9,438 | 1,036 | 10,474 |

Chapman University competes in the NCAA as part of the Southern California Intercollegiate Athletic Conf..
Chapman fields 714 student athletes — 412 men and 302 women across 16 varsity sports.
